Bard core: All the world—or at least a small part of Rome—was a stage for Kevin Kline while filming a movie adaptation of A Midsummer Night's Dream, performed in turn-of-the-century costume. Kline, as Bottom, costars with Michelle Pfeiffer, Rupert Everett and Calista Flockhart in the film, due next year.

Goldie Hawn—in Manhattan to film a remake of The Out-of-Towners with Steve Martin—took a break to pedal around the city with 11-year-old son Wyatt (Dad is longtime love Kurt Russell). Proponents of safe cycling, both wore helmets.

The ensemble cast of Homicide was guilty of partying in the first degree at a Baltimore bash celebrating the NBC drama's 100th episode. Revelers included Jon Seda (below), fervently strumming air, and costar Richard Belzer (right), who lavished attention, and mustard, on a wiener. Kyle Secor (above, with a partygoer) created the evening's biggest buzz with his newly shaved head. "It's like an emancipation proclamation," says Secor of the trim. Seda was moved: "I love you, man! I love the haircut!"
